The order (h) of the point group is just the sum of all symmetry operations in the point group. The C 3v point group operations E, C 3, and σ v correspond to E, (123), and (23)* in terms of permutation and permutation-inversion operations (1, 2, and 3 identify the three hydrogen nuclei), and multiplication by (E, E*) generates the D 3h (M) molecular group (see Table 5. Any given set of atomic orbitals {\(\phi_i\)}, atom-centered displacements, or rotations can be used as a basis for the symmetry operations of the point group of the molecule. The discrete (or finite) groups have a finite order (for example C2v is a group of fourth order), while continuous groupshaveinfiniteorders(C∞v forexample). The order of the C 3v point group is 6, and the order of the principal axis (C 3) is 3.
